Select the correct statement:A. tendril of a pea plant and phylloclade of Opuntia are homologousB. tendril of a pea plant and phylloclade of Opuntia are analogousC. wings of birds and limbs of lizards are analogousD. wings of birds and wings of bat are homologous |
|
Answer» The tendril of a pea plant and phylloclade of Opuntia are both stem joints. They have similar basic structure and thus are homologous. |
